The history of the color in our past
The use of the color red in human clothing dates back to prehistoric times. Red ochre, a natural pigment found in many parts of the world, was used by early humans as body paint, to decorate clothing and pottery, and even in burial rituals.
In ancient civilizations, such as Egypt, Greece, and Rome, red clothing was often reserved for the wealthy and powerful. In some cultures, red clothing was also associated with religious significance and was worn by priests and other religious figures.
During the Middle Ages in Europe, red was a popular color for both men and women's clothing. It was often used in clothing worn by royalty and nobility, and was associated with wealth and luxury.
In more recent history, the color red has continued to be a popular choice for clothing. During the 20th century, red was often associated with political movements, such as the socialist and communist movements. It was also a popular color in fashion, particularly in the 1980s and 1990s, when bright colors were in style.

Studies explain the relationship between RED and attraction:
There have been several studies conducted on the relationship between the color red and attraction, here are a few examples:
In one study, researchers found that men were more attracted to women wearing red than to women wearing other colors. The study involved showing men photographs of women wearing red, blue, green, or gray and asking them to rate the women's attractiveness. The men consistently rated the women wearing red as more attractive and sexually desirable than the women wearing other colors (Elliot & Niesta, 2008).
Another study found that men were more likely to ask out a woman wearing a red shirt than a woman wearing a blue shirt. The study involved having a woman wear either a red or blue shirt and asking men on a college campus to rate her attractiveness and indicate whether they would be interested in dating her. The men were more likely to rate the woman wearing red as more attractive and to express interest in dating her (Hill & Barton, 2005).
A third study found that men perceived women's faces as more attractive when they were framed by a red border rather than a border of another color. The study involved showing men photographs of women's faces framed by different colors and asking them to rate the women's attractiveness. The men consistently rated the women's faces as more attractive when they were framed by red (Elliot et al., 2010).

Effect on men:
Research has also found that wearing red can increase a woman's perceived attractiveness and sex appeal in the eyes of men. For example, studies have shown that men rate women wearing red as more attractive and desirable than women wearing other colors or neutral clothing.
One possible explanation for this effect is that red is a signal of fertility and reproductive potential. In nature, red is often associated with ripe fruit and healthy, vibrant plants, which can signal a potential mate's reproductive fitness. Therefore, men may be more attracted to women wearing red because it signals their potential as a mate who is healthy and fertile.
